Culture & Truth: The Remaking of Social AnalysisBeacon Press, 1 ส.ค. 1993 - 280 หน้า Exposing the inadequacies of old conceptions of static cultures and detached observers, the book argues instead for social science to acknowledge and celebrate diversity, narrative, emotion, and subjectivity. |
